How they compare

Czechia currently reports 568 m3 against 187 m3 in Russian Federation, a difference of 381 m3.

That makes Czechia's figure about 3.0 times Russian Federation's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 20 shared years of data; in 1997 it was Russian Federation ahead.

Czechia ranks 10th and Russian Federation ranks 13th of 37 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Czechia averaged higher in 2 and Russian Federation in 1.
